Transaction 27a38f261d5096a9096f9ea2047090373530fc92c5bb1506a43ac016e121aac7
1 Input
1 Output
-
27a38f261d5096a9096f9ea2047090373530fc92c5bb1506a43ac016e121aac7:0
- value
- 28439039
- script pubkey
- OP_0 OP_PUSHBYTES_20 a66b7dc5fbc6761f1bc575c3c957e6da4a2c3808
- address
- ltc1q5e4hm30mcemp7x79whpuj4lxmf9zcwqgh39nw3